Brian Gregory Mascord was born in Newcastle NSW on 30 January 1959—the eldest son of Ron and Margaret Mascord (nee Callinan) and older brother to John. He grew up in the parish of St Mary Immaculate Charlestown (now part of the MacKillop Parish incorporating Charlestown, Gateshead and Redhead.) Through the gift of his grandparents, Brian has a close relationship with his extended family.

Father Bernard Dowdell is the chaplain to the Wollongong Hospital. His responsibility is a great one. There are some parishioners who assist him in this ministry: they visit the Catholic patients and bring them Holy Communion. There are also parish visitors who reach out to the Catholic residents in the following local care facilities:

  • Coniston Nursing Home, Coniston
  • Horizon Nursing Home, Wollongong
  • Diment Towers, Mangerton
  • Bishop McCabe Retirement Village, Towradgi
  • Towradgi Nursing Home
  • Olunda Nursing Home, North Wollongong
